Simplify missing whole_static_libs checking

Whole_static_libs required custom error checking when
AllowMissingDependencies was set because it could end up depending
on an empty list of objects, which would leave nothing in the
dependency tree that had been replaced with an ErrorRule.
Reuse the prebuilts case to depend on the .a file when there
are no objects and remove the custom error handling.

Test: TestEmptyWholeStaticLibsAllowMissingDependencies

func TestEmptyWholeStaticLibsAllowMissingDependencies(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
bp := `
cc_library_static {
name: "libfoo",
srcs: ["foo.c"],
whole_static_libs: ["libbar"],
}
cc_library_static {
name: "libbar",
whole_static_libs: ["libmissing"],
}
`
config := TestConfig(buildDir, android.Android, nil, bp, nil)
config.TestProductVariables.Allow_missing_dependencies = BoolPtr(true)
ctx := CreateTestContext()
ctx.SetAllowMissingDependencies(true)
ctx.Register(config)
_, errs := ctx.ParseFileList(".", []string{"Android.bp"})
android.FailIfErrored(t, errs)
_, errs = ctx.PrepareBuildActions(config)
android.FailIfErrored(t, errs)
libbar := ctx.ModuleForTests("libbar", "android_arm64_armv8-a_static").Output("libbar.a")
if g, w := libbar.Rule, android.ErrorRule; g != w {
t.Fatalf("Expected libbar rule to be %q, got %q", w, g)
}
if g, w := libbar.Args["error"], "missing dependencies: libmissing"; !strings.Contains(g, w) {
t.Errorf("Expected libbar error to contain %q, was %q", w, g)
}
libfoo := ctx.ModuleForTests("libfoo", "android_arm64_armv8-a_static").Output("libfoo.a")
if g, w := libfoo.Inputs.Strings(), libbar.Output.String(); !android.InList(w, g) {
t.Errorf("Expected libfoo.a to depend on %q, got %q", w, g)
}
}
